i recently did my OME 891 install and decided to not go with the cones.
although you can if you want because mainly it will give you a slightly higher lift, maybe 3/8"s or so. also some say that it will help with non metal to metal contact between the coil and the body.
but i chose to not install becaues 3/8" to me isnt much and i havent had any issues with the coil contact when it was on my 97 since they didnt come with cones anyway.
also the OME 891 probably wont even get close to using those cones for their purpose anyway.
MAIN reason i chose not to install was because i noticed there could be a possbility under full flex that the cones would limit my compression and that outweighs the benefits listed above for me.
i rather have more flex up and down then to have 3/8"~ possible lift.
